A 3-year-old girl reportedly jumped out of a car while she was being driven by a teacher to her first day of preschool in Rompin, Pahang, leaving the girl with severe oral injuries that necessitated surgery under general anaesthesia and over 20 stitches.

According to a report by Sin Chew Daily, the girl’s mother shared that the incident took place less than 5 minutes after her teacher had fetched her.

A 3-year-old girl suffered severe injuries after reportedly jumping out of a car on her first day of preschool in Rompin

The mother initially assumed that the girl had only sustained scratches when the teacher had called her to inform her about the incident. However, when she realised that the girl had yet to return home after the phone call, she drove over to the scene of the incident to check for herself.

“When I arrived at the scene, I saw that my child’s clothes were covered in blood, and blood was flowing from her mouth. I immediately took her to the hospital emergency room,” she stated.

The circumstances leading to the girl jumping from the vehicle remain unclear.

 

The extent of her injuries

After an examination, the hospital’s doctor explained that the girl’s injuries were quite serious and required referral to a dentist for further treatment.

It turned out that the girl not only had a wound on the outside of her lip but also severe tears to her gums.

Thankfully, the girl received the treatment that she needed and has since returned home to recuperate.

However, the girl is currently unable to eat normally and is restricted to a liquid diet of milk and medication administered via spoon.

. Her injuries also need to be disinfected and sprayed with medicine regularly to prevent infection, and she needs to go for check-ups every week.

“I still feel lingering fear when I think about it. I just hope my child can recover soon.”
